Responsible for the day-to-day coordination of staff, you will lead a dynamic team of nurses to deliver clinical excellence within our Health Centre.
As the Clinical Team Leader, you will be responsible for ensuring the delivery of quality health services to prisoners. In providing best practice clinical health care, you will assess and treat individuals with a wide range of medical conditions and interface with custodial staff to resolve any issues.
You will also support the Health Centre Manager with the implementation of new policies and initiatives, whilst encouraging a culture of continuous improvement.
The successful applicant will possess:
-An advanced knowledge and experience in a primary health care setting
-Proven leadership or managerial skills
-A philosophy of care, ensuring staff systems and processes are focused on meeting patient needs
-The provision of culturally safe health care
-Exceptional communication and relationship skills
-Strong analysis and reporting capability to monitor and improve our service delivery
Our Nurses enjoy genuine work-life balance a wide range of practice work, and an environment where professional development is encouraged.
Bring your nursing skills and a desire to make a positive impact. With Corrections you will find an environment where your leadership capability will be harnessed to its full potential.
